Zanchulese (natively: Zánṣyl Óẓ [ˈzɑːn.t͡ʂɨɫ oːd͡ʐ]) is a Sesjan language closely related to Xadwg. It was once spoken on both coasts of the Amujan Sea, but is now only spoken on its southern coast. It is a co-official language of the CMCic territory of Duzhauzech. Along with that, it was the official language of the People's Free City of Amuj before its dissolution in the conclusion of the Amujxplosion.

Phonology

Consonants

Zanchulese has 35 consonants, of which 29 are phonemic:

Consonants Labial Alveolar Retroflex Palatal Velar Uvular Glottal
Nasal /m/ /n/ [ɳ][1] /ɲ/ ⟨ṇ⟩ /ɴ/[2] ⟨ŋ⟩
Plosive Voiceless /p/ /t/ /t͡ʂ/[2] ⟨ṣ⟩ [c][3] /k/ /q/[2] ⟨ḳ⟩ /ʔ/[4] ⟨'⟩
Voiced /b/ /d/ /d͡ʐ/[2] ⟨ẓ⟩ [ɟ][3] /g/ /ɢ/[2] ⟨ġ⟩
Fricative Voiceless /f/ /s/ /ʂ/[5] ⟨c⟩ [ç][3] /x/ ⟨q⟩ /χ/[2] ⟨q̇⟩
Voiced /v/ /z/ /ʐ/[5] ⟨x⟩ [ʝ][3] /ɣ/ ⟨h⟩ /ʁ/[2] ⟨ḥ⟩
Liquid /w/[5] /ɫ/[5] ⟨l⟩ [ɻ][1] /j/ ⟨j⟩ (w) /ʀ/[5] ⟨r⟩
  1. 1.0 1.1 These sounds occur when the phonemes /ɲ j/ come into contact with the phonemes /t͡ʂ d͡ʐ ʂ ʐ/
  2. 2.0 2.1 2.2 2.3 2.4 2.5 2.6 These phonemes are exclusive to Zanchulese
  3. 3.0 3.1 3.2 3.3 These sounds occur when the phonemes /k g x ɣ/ come into contact with the phonemes /ɲ j/
  4. Evolved from Sesjan intervocalic /h/
  5. 5.0 5.1 5.2 5.3 5.4 These phonemes are cognate with Xadwg /ʃ ʒ β̞ l r/

Vowels

Zanchulese has 6 phonemic vowels[1], each with 2 phonemic lengths[2]:

Vowels Front Central Back
High Short /i/ /ɨ/ ⟨y⟩ /u/
Long /iː/ ⟨í⟩ /ɨː/ ⟨ý⟩ /uː/ ⟨ú⟩
Mid Short /e/ /o/
Long /eː/ ⟨é⟩ /oː/ ⟨ó⟩
Low Short /ɑ/
Long /ɑː/ ⟨á⟩
  1. Unlike in Xadwg, Zanchulese merged /ə əː/ with /ɑ ɑː/ (its cognates of Sesje /a/) in its evolution from Sesje.
  2. Also unlike in Xadwg, Zanchulese kept Sesje's vocalic length distinction for the former's 6 vowels.

Orthography

The words "Zánṣyl Óẓ" written in the Solar Script

Zanchulese is written in the Solar Script, a "featural-ish" abugida designed by Orest of Oressia.
